Grinnell, Iowa

Grinnell is a city in Poweshiek County, Iowa, United States. The population was 9,105 at the 2000 census. Grinnell was named after Josiah Bushnell Grinnell and is the home of Grinnell College.

Grinnell Careers

Among the most common occupations in Grinnell are Management, professional, and related occupations, 31%. Sales and office occupations, 20%. and Service occupations, 19%. Approximately 80 percent of workers in Grinnell, Iowa work for companies, 9 percent work for the government and 5 percent are self-employed.

Grinnell Industries

The leading industries in Grinnell, Iowa are Educational, health and social services, 33%; Manufacturing, 17%; and Retail trade, 10%. Grinnell Job Salaries

According to government data, the average salary for jobs in Grinnell, Iowa is $28,910, and the median income of households in Grinnell was $35,625.

Grinnell Unemployment Rate

Grinnell has an unemployment rate of 6.0%, compared the national average of 5.8%.
